如何使用DE0-Nano开发板实现一个简单的FPGA项目,包括硬件连接和软件编程?请提供具体步骤和注意事项。
时间: 2024-11-26 20:34:50 浏览: 23
DE0-Nano开发板是一个功能强大的平台,可以用于学习和实现FPGA相关的项目。为了帮助你开始你的FPGA之旅,推荐参阅《DE0-Nano开发板用户手册:探索FPGA功能与应用》。手册中提供了丰富的信息和指南,从硬件架构到软件编程,为你提供了实用的入门知识。
参考资源链接:[DE0-Nano开发板用户手册:探索FPGA功能与应用](https://wenku.csdn.net/doc/647e94dbd12cbe7ec3446b38?spm=1055.2569.3001.10343)
首先,你需要熟悉DE0-Nano开发板的硬件资源,包括Cyclone IV FPGA、SDRAM、I2C Serial EEPROM、扩展引脚、A/D转换器、数字加速度计等。了解如何连接和操作这些组件是实现FPGA项目的首要步骤。
其次,在硬件连接方面,确保所有的电源和接地引脚正确连接,以便为开发板供电。此外,对于任何外设如加速度计、EEPROM等,你需要确保按照手册中的布局与组件章节进行正确连接。
在软件编程方面,你可能需要安装Quartus Prime软件进行FPGA的配置和编程。通过系统构建器,你可以导入所需的IP核,并配置相应的接口。根据手册中的系统构建器章节,你可以按照提供的步骤和示例来创建自己的FPGA项目。
当你完成了硬件的搭建和软件的编写后,可以使用DE0-Nano控制面板来进行项目的调试。控制面板允许你监控开发板上的各种功能,如LED灯的状态、按键输入等,这对于测试和验证你的设计至关重要。
最后,根据教程章节中的指导,从零开始逐步实现你的设计。学习如何规划项目、设置开发环境、编写代码以及测试结果。通过实际操作,你将能够掌握FPGA项目的整个流程。
希望这些信息能帮助你成功地开始使用DE0-Nano开发板。为了更深入地学习FPGA设计和应用,鼓励你继续参阅《DE0-Nano开发板用户手册:探索FPGA功能与应用》,这本手册将是你实现更多复杂项目的宝贵资源。
参考资源链接:[DE0-Nano开发板用户手册:探索FPGA功能与应用](https://wenku.csdn.net/doc/647e94dbd12cbe7ec3446b38?spm=1055.2569.3001.10343)
阅读全文